Hilton Garden Inn Houston/Sugar Land
29.60653, -95.64273The 3-star Hilton Garden Inn Houston/Sugar Land lies 3.1 km from a natural paradise like Cullinan Park, and features a restaurant and a storage for belongings. This Sugar Land inn offers to indulge in a Jacuzzi and an outdoor swimming pool or take a refreshing dip in an outdoor pool area, before discovering the secrets of American cuisine served at à la carte restaurant.
Location
The property is situated 10 minutes by car from Colony Bend, while Fort Bend Children's Discovery Center is a 25-minute walk away. Guests can go to Surfside Beach, which is 66 km from the Hilton Garden Inn Houston/Sugar Land Sugar Land. The accommodation is 10 minutes by car from Brazos River Park.
For those travelling from afar, William P. Hobby airport is 43 minutes' drive away.
Rooms
You can stay in one of the 202 air-conditioned rooms featuring a flat-screen TV with satellite channels along with coffee and tea making facilities. Also, they feature tiled flooring. The en suite bathrooms come with a hairdryer. Guests can also enjoy views of the pool. Self-catering facilities in an apartment include a kitchenette with a cooktop, a washing machine, and glassware.
Eat & Drink
The Hilton Garden Inn Houston/Sugar Land offers breakfast in the restaurant. The Hilton Garden Inn Houston/Sugar Land Sugar Land features Garden restaurant. You can visit a restaurant situated close by and taste healthy cuisine.
Leisure & Business
Guests can enjoy a summer terrace and a community pool for an extra charge. This Sugar Land hotel goes the extra mile to provide guests with fitness classes to help them stay fit. Business travellers are welcome to use a business centre offered on site.
